Ahead of its debut at the upcoming Frankfurt Motor Show, BMW has introduced enthusiasts and the world to the all-new and highly controversial BMW M5 2018. Having traded its signature Rear-Wheel-Drive layout for an arguably better All-Wheel-Drive platform, the F90 M5 is one that is bound to make its way into the history books.

With power swelling to levels that would simply shred the rear tires, the all-new M5 features the latest edition of the brand’s 4.4-liter twin-turbocharged V8 to channel 600-horsepower and 750 Nm of torque through an eight-speed ZF transmission. When powering all four wheels, the BMW M5 2018 hits 100 km/h in a neck-snapping 3.4-seconds and 200 km/h in 11.1-seconds, making it the fastest accelerating BMW of all time.

“Thanks to M xDrive, the new BMW M5 goes beyond the precise, agile drive that we’ve come to expect – it also serves up a noticeable boost in traction and controllability, both in everyday situations and at the dynamic limit.” said former Formula One driver and BMW works driver, Timo Glock.

Although top speed is restricted to 250 km/h, the limiter can be bumped up to a that’s-more-like-it 305 km/h with the optional M Driver’s Package. Numerous drive modes (4WD DSC, 4WD Sport, 2WD) allow the all-new M5 to transform from a track annihilating weapon to an outright hooligan in a matter of seconds.

What BMW has made sure of, however, is that even in the simplest of settings, the M5 offers a decent amount of slip before reeling the car back in. The “4WD Sport” mode switches the stability control system to “M Dynamic Mode” for greater rear-wheel bias, more slip and better angles. Unleashing its full potential, the “2WD” mode disconnects the front axle completely and allows the driver to engage in an intimate moment of man and machine.
